Journal of System Simulation ›› 2021, Vol. 33 ›› Issue (8): 1980-1988.doi: 10.16182/j.issn1004731x.joss.20-0277

Previous Articles     Next Articles

Two-Point Joint CPA Attacks Against AES and Its Simulation

Tong Yu1,2, Cai Jingwen3   

  1. 1. Department of Information Technology (Network Supervision), Hunan Police College, Changsha 410138, China;
    2. Hunan Provincial Key Laboratory of Cybercrime Investigation, Changsha 410138, China;
    3. College of Computer and Information Security, Guilin University of Electronic Science and Technology, Guilin 541004, China
  • Received:2020-05-28 Revised:2020-08-01 Published:2021-08-19

Abstract: Aiming at the problems of large sampling amount and low utilization rate of attack information in single-point power analysis attack, a method of two-point joint power analysis attack for AES (Advanced Encryption Standard) is proposed. This method selects two power leakage points for power analysis according to the correlation between the power leakage points and the key in the AES. By constructing a power leakage model of intermediate variables, an intermediate value joint function is established which means, the method can be used to recover the key of AES. The simulation results demonstrate that the attack time of the two-point joint power analysis attack is reduced by 33.23% compared to two independent single-point power analysis attacks using 5 000 power curves, and the success rate of the two-point joint power analysis attack is significantly higher than that of the single-point power analysis attack with fewer power curve samples.

Key words: side-channel analysis, power analysis attack, Advanced Encryption Standard(AES), power leakage model, two-point joint attack

CLC Number: